
The Valor Christian Eagles easily put away the Dakota Ridge Eagles by a score of 79-53 on Wednesday.
Valor Christian was paced in scoring by Amondo Miller who put up 19 points while also recording three rebounds and two assists. Roger Rosengarten and Aj Kula also had solid performances contributing 17 points and 14 points, respectively.
Dakota Ridge was lead in scoring by Taeshaud Jackson jr. who accounted for 18 points, while also recording 13 rebounds and one assist. Hunter Hickman had a productive night, recording 12 points, two rebounds and two assists.
In their next games, Valor Christian will play host to Arvada West, while Dakota Ridge will travel to play Columbine.
